👋 Hi, I'm Lukas Hedegaard

PostDoc at Aarhus University, Denmark researching Deep Learning, network acceleration and Transfer Learning applied to Computer Vision and Natural Language Processing. Recent works include:

Apart from doing ML research projects (like real-time Human Activity Recognition using CoX3D ☝️), I like to package code up nicely and open-source whenever it may be of value. Open-source libraries include:

  • Continual Inference [🐍, C++] downloads - Building blocks for Continual Inference Networks in PyTorch.
  • Ride [🐍] downloads - Training wheels, side rails, and helicopter parent for your Deep Learning projects in PyTorch.
  • OpenDR [🐍, C++] downloads - A modular, open and non-proprietary toolkit for core robotic functionalities by harnessing deep learning.
  • DatasetOps [🐍] downloads - Fluent dataset operations, compatible with your favorite libraries.
  • PyTorch Benchmark [🐍] downloads - Easily benchmark PyTorch model FLOPs, latency, throughput, allocated gpu memory and energy consumption.
  • Co-Rider [🐍] downloads - Tiny configuration library tailored for the Ride ecosystem.
  • Supers [🐍] downloads - Call a function in all superclasses using supers(self).foo(42).
  • react-native-svg-pan-zoom [JS] downloads - Pan-zoom via two-finger "Google Maps"-style pinch and drag gestures.
  • redux-maybe [JS] downloads - Nodejs Package for attaching callback functions to redux messages.
  • redux-blabber [JS] downloads - Redux store enhancer for synchronizing states and actions across store instances.
